Chase Capes wants to keep his perfect record intact for as long as possible. Article content

The St. Patrick’s Grade 11 student is a four-time winner this fall after taking the senior boys’ race at the LKSSAA cross-country championship Thursday at Canatara Park. Article content Article content

“So far, I’m undefeated and hopefully keeping that until OFSAA,” he said. “I’ll see what happens at SWOSSAA.”

The SWOSSAA meet is this Thursday at Windsor’s Malden Park.

Capes completed the six-kilometre course at LKSSAA in 20:19 while battling bad cramps.

“I still pushed through it and I still came out with a decent time,” he said after winning by one minute 39 seconds over Fighting Irish teammate Ryan Ladouceur.
